Hales and Lumb destroy Kiwis, take series: 3rd T20 (Wellington)

Alex Hales (80 not out off 44 balls) and Michael Lumb's record opening stand carried England to a 10-wicket win over New Zealand to clinch the series 2-1. Earlier, wickets fell at regular intervals as Martin Guptill held the innings together with 59 to post 139-8. England 143 for 0 (Hales 80*, Lumb 53*) beat New Zealand 139 for 8 (Guptill 59, Broad 3-15) by 10 wickets. 3rd T20 (Wellington), Feb 2013
